|
Nature of Business - Additional Information (Detail)
|12 Months Ended
|
Jun. 30, 2012
|
Jun. 30, 2010
Entity
|Organization and Nature of Operations [Line Items]
|Number of principal revenue lines
|4
|Number of securitization trusts consolidated
|14
|
Trust
|Organization and Nature of Operations [Line Items]
|Number of securitization trusts consolidated
|11
|
NCT Trusts
|Organization and Nature of Operations [Line Items]
|Number of securitization trusts consolidated
|3
|X
|
- Definition
Number of Sources of Revenues
No definition available.
|X
|
- Definition
Number of Variable Interest Entities, Consolidated
No definition available.
|X
|
- Details